Transaction 716c866eb72e591f0056626931484c5625a88cc204d17efeb342bdd671d45f8a

3 Input
2 Outputs
  • 716c866eb72e591f0056626931484c5625a88cc204d17efeb342bdd671d45f8a:0
  • value  54536
    address  16dBeHWo5wytYL4h5ZobBRsUNgbMK2wzyG
  • 716c866eb72e591f0056626931484c5625a88cc204d17efeb342bdd671d45f8a:1
  • value  3826350
    address  19pAuXjLmCiHvLAqMXzHCsDHaKfxcg12zB